Job Summary

*Flexible Work Arrangement: Hybrid*

The Stability Engineer will perform reliability analysis in support of the development of the New Services Requests in the PJM Interconnection PJM Interconnection Process involves the study of various types of New Services requests which are submitted by Project Developers and Eligible proposed interconnections are evaluated by the Interconnection Analysis (IA) Interconnection Planning Analysis group for compliance with NERC and RFC standards as well as PJM and Transmission Owner planning principles. The Engineer will also engage in a variety of other adequacy and reliability assessments that support the planning function and the main goals and objectives of the IA department.


Essential Functions:

  • Perform power system analysis and dynamic stability analysis required in the development of System Impact Study reports for New Service Requests.
  • Evaluate transmission system reinforcements required to resolve reliability issues on the transmission system identified through analysis.
  • Work with Transmission Owner staff in the development and refinement of the required reinforcements necessary to maintain the reliability of the transmission system.
  • Support data reviews for New Service Requests prior to inclusion in base case model for analysis.
  • Support the creation and maintenance of power flow and dynamics cases and individual project models used for analysis by IPA.
  • Manage multiple projects and coordinate with PJM contractors to delegate prioritize and review the work performed by them
  • Prepare technical reports and/or presentations of analyses performed conclusions and recommendations
  • Support PJM business practice manual development updates and communication to stakeholders.
  • Identify coordinate and assist with the development of new and innovative methods in the planning process.
  • Work with other members of the System Planning Division to solve complex engineering problems and to resolve process coordination issues.
  • Represent PJM on industry committees task forces or stakeholder groups involving issues related to planning and engineering.
